Navigating the Recuperation Process



As you navigate the recuperation procedure after refractive surgical procedure, it's necessary to follow your specialist's directions very closely to make sure the best feasible result.

You'll likely experience some pain and blurred vision at first, which is typical. Rest your eyes as high as feasible, preventing displays and brilliant lights for the very first couple of days.

Do not forget to make use of the prescribed eye drops to prevent dryness and promote recovery. Use sunglasses outdoors to protect your eyes from UV rays.

It's crucial to stay clear of rubbing your eyes and follow any task limitations your specialist recommends, especially in the initial week.



Keep all follow-up appointments to check your healing progress, and do not think twice to reach out to your specialist with any kind of problems.
